A Scenic Winter Drive

I took the Byblos–Ehmej road to reach Laqlouq, where most of the chalets and houses lay nestled beneath a thick blanket of snow, their rooftops and surroundings immersed in a pristine white embrace. Meanwhile, children reveled in the magic of winter, their laughter echoing through the crisp mountain air as they played in the powdery snow.

Located 69 kilometers from Beirut and perched at an altitude of approximately 1,800 meters above sea level, Laqlouq falls within the Byblos district, making it one of Lebanon’s most breathtaking highland retreats.

A Timeless Oasis of Flowing Springs and Seasonal Beauty

The name "Laqlouq" carries multiple interpretations, one of which suggests it originates from the Arabic verb "laqlaq", referring to the continuous flow of its abundant, ever-rushing waters—a phenomenon you’ll soon discover. This mountain retreat is blessed with natural springs, crystal-clear ponds, and earthy water reservoirs that sustain its fertile lands through spring and summer, transforming it into a living oasis that evolves with the seasons.

Between golden fields and snow-draped landscapes, between icy chills and sunlit warmth, Laqlouq unveils some of Lebanon’s most breathtaking natural scenes. Its traditional houses and elegant villas blend seamlessly with lush greenery in winter and rolling white hills in summer, forming a mesmerizing masterpiece shaped by time and reimagined by the changing seasons—a view that never ceases to captivate.
